Abstract
The utility model relates to a pressing roller mold. The pressing roller mold comprises a circular pressing roller mold main body, wherein a matching groove is formed on the inner side of the pressing roller mold main body. The matching groove is formed on the inner side of the pressing roller mold main body, so the pressing roller mold can be matched and fixed with a pressing roller shaft through the matching groove, is difficult to loosen during use, is easy to maintain, and has a low failure rate.
